Ohio surgery center marks 15 years

USPI affiliate Mayfield Spine Surgery Center recently celebrated its 15th year serving patients in the Cincinnati area.

Advertisement

The physician-owned center’s surgeons have completed more than 86,000 outpatient procedures since its inception in 2007, according to a Sept. 27 news release from the center. 

“We are proud to commemorate [our staff’s] dedication to serving Cincinnati and we look forward to making a continued impact over the next 15 years and beyond,” Brad Skidmore, MD, chairman of the center, said in the release.
